Anyway, after you score two lines at the bottom edge, stamp your sentiment and tie a bow of your color choice... and BAM! Your card is done!
Note: if you happen to do a sloppy job when stamping your sentiment, like I did with this one, just cover up your mistake by stamping it again on another piece of card stock, trim and place over your mistake. Actually, this looks even better because of the colorful border I added (which I had to do because my smudge underneath was still showing).
